Output 66bb65517cbff518d5e9d6a429cbd22a460573950595b4066c4392cc535304a4:1

value
18398459
script pubkey
OP_0 OP_PUSHBYTES_20 75211793a66c6b635ecc64dcb14c5a2830d72008
address
bc1qw5s30yaxd34kxhkvvnwtznz69qcdwgqgnft694
transaction
66bb65517cbff518d5e9d6a429cbd22a460573950595b4066c4392cc535304a4